Smart Access is a mid-sized software development company based in San Francisco, California. Its platform turns static procedures into actionable workflows, linking coaching and skill-building to daily operations. It is designed for operators and engineers who view execution as critical.

The platform provides performance analytics and frontline feedback tools to support operational performance, tying daily work to measurable outcomes. It targets large distribution operations and frames its offering as a frontline workforce platform connected to operational outcomes. In 2023, Smart Access launched a Labor Management solution in collaboration with Connors Group.
